Decentralized escrow services function by locking digital assets into autonomous smart contracts to ensure counterparty performance within financial derivative trades. This mechanism eliminates the necessity for a traditional intermediary, shifting the burden of trust from institutional entities to immutable programmatic logic. By sequestering margin or underlying assets, these systems mitigate default risk during the lifecycle of an options contract.
